Apple has issued a new security research challenge for hackers with the main aim being the company protecting its Private Cloud Compute (PCC) servers. The company has said that if you are successful in hacking Apple’s PCC servers, you could earn up to $1 million.

BlackBerry reported a net loss of US$19 million in its second quarter, with revenue for the quarter US$145 million, just up from US$144 million during the same quarter last year.
